My latest FOTD/tutorial is a peachy warm look that I love for adding some heat to those cold winter days.  Click here to watch the video on how to achieve this look!  To see what I'm wearing on face and nails, scroll on down!!




FACE:
- e.l.f. mineral infused face primer
- Maybelline mineral power liquid foundation in porcelain ivory
- Palladio herbal eyeshadow primer (prime undereye)
- Sally Hansen fast fix concealer in all over-brightener (undereye)
- Maybelline Dream Mousse Concealer in Light 1-2: Ivory (undereye)
- Maybelline Dream Matte Powder in Cream
- Physician’s Formula healthy wear SPF 50 bronzer in fair (all over face/neck)
- Physician’s Formula Mineral Wear Talc Free Mineral Blush in Blushing Glow (apples and into hairline)
- Wet N Wild Ultimate Minerals Bronzer in Amber Glow (apples of cheeks)
- N.Y.C. bronzer in sunny (contour)
- Wet N Wild Mega Glow Illuminating Face Powder in Spotlight Peach



EYES:
- Too Faced shadow insurance
- Savvy Eye Savvy Satin Eyeshadow in Iced Peach (lid)
- CoverGirl single in Mink (crease, blending shade)
- CoverGirl single in Swiss Chocolate (crease)
- Wet N Wild ColorIcon Single Eyeshadow in Brulee (highlight)
- Wet N Wild Mega Glow Illuminating Face Powder in Spotlight Peach (coral shade in crease)
- Jesse’s Girl Kohl Eyeliner Pencil in Treasure Hunt (bottom lashes)
- CoverGirl perfect point plus eyeliner pencil in espresso (top lashes/waterline)
- Maybelline great lash BIG mascara in blackest black (volume)
- Wet N Wild MegaLength Mascara (length)



LIPS:
- Wet N Wild MegaSlicks Lip Color Pencil in in Peach Fuzz
- Revlon Colorburst Lipgloss in Sunset Peach



NAILS: Wet N Wild Craze Nail Color in Shield
